Description
This truly exquisite period property provides a rare opportunity to purchase a unique and historical family home located in the heart of Dublin 7. The property is one of nine late nineteenth-century houses forming Charleville Terrace on the North Circular Road. The terrace was named after Charleville House in Wicklow, the estate of Charles Stanley Viscount Monck, who developed this stretch of road in the 1870s. About the Area
The North Circular Road is an important thoroughfare on the northside of Dublin. The regional road was long considered the northern boundary of the city and still separates the city centre from the inner suburbs. It runs from the Phoenix Park in the west through Phibsboro, to North Wall in the east and is the location of a number of important institutions, The Mater Hospital, Dalymount Park and Mountjoy Prison are on the North Circular Road and both Croke Park and St. Brendan's Hospital are nearby.
